:root{--bg: #0b0d12;--bg-soft: #11141b;--fg: #f3f4f6;--fg-muted: #9ca3af;--accent: #f59e0b;--accent-hover: #fbbf24;--border: #1f2530;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,sans-serif;color-scheme:dark}*{box-sizing:border-box;margin:0;padding:0}html,body{background:var(--bg);color:var(--fg);min-height:100vh}a{color:var(--accent);text-decoration:none}a:hover{color:var(--accent-hover)}.container{max-width:1100px;margin:0 auto;padding:0 24px}header{padding:28px 0;border-bottom:1px solid var(--border)}.nav{display:flex;justify-content:space-between;align-items:center}.brand{font-weight:700;font-size:22px;letter-spacing:-.02em}.brand span{color:var(--accent)}.nav-links a{margin-left:24px;color:var(--fg-muted);font-size:14px}.nav-links a:hover{color:var(--fg)}.btn{display:inline-block;padding:12px 22px;border-radius:8px;background:var(--accent);color:#0b0d12;font-weight:600}.btn:hover{background:var(--accent-hover);color:#0b0d12}.hero{padding:100px 0 80px;text-align:center}.hero h1{font-size:56px;line-height:1.05;letter-spacing:-.03em;margin-bottom:20px}.hero h1 span{color:var(--accent)}.hero p{font-size:20px;color:var(--fg-muted);max-width:640px;margin:0 auto 36px;line-height:1.5}.features{padding:60px 0;border-top:1px solid var(--border);display:grid;gr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:32px}.feature h3{font-size:18px;margin-bottom:8px}.feature p{color:var(--fg-muted);font-size:14px;line-height:1.6}footer{padding:40px 0;border-top:1px solid var(--border);color:var(--fg-muted);font-size:13px;text-align:center;margin-top:80px}@media(max-width:640px){.hero h1{font-size:36px}.hero p{font-size:16px}}
